Scott Burgess | Prep Redzone Scout
Rios is a PRZ Illinois favorite. He has landed offers from UMass, Cornell, Akron, San Diego State, Western Illinois, and Western Kentucky. We truly believe he is a legit P4 offensive lineman with his athleticism and elite pass protection ability. At that level we can definitely see him kicking inside to guard where he would be a mobile and athletic interior offensive lineman with all conference pass pro upside!

Read EvaluationScott Burgess | Prep Redzone Scout
Rios is one of the best tackles in the class. The 6’5″ 290 pound right tackle started on a state title team as a sophomore. Wide body and excellent footwork. Big time in pass protection with his typewriter feet, mirroring, and how light he plays for his size. Great technique. Has the size and length to be a mauler in the run game as well. Chance to be a complete tackle.
